Closed Bug 1998628 Opened 4 months ago Closed 4 months ago

Release custom review prompt by default, keep the flag to control triggers/criteria

Categories

(Firefox for Android :: Experimentation and Telemetry, task)

All
Android
task

Tracking

()

RESOLVED FIXED
147 Branch
Tracking Status
firefox145 --- fixed
firefox146 --- fixed
firefox147 --- fixed

People

(Reporter: mkozinski, Assigned: mkozinski)

References

(Blocks 1 open bug)

Details

(Whiteboard: [fxdroid][group2])

Attachments

(9 files)

48 bytes, text/x-phabricator-request
Details | Review
48 bytes, text/x-phabricator-request
Details | Review
48 bytes, text/x-phabricator-request
Details | Review
48 bytes, text/x-phabricator-request
Details | Review
48 bytes, text/x-phabricator-request
Details | Review
48 bytes, text/x-phabricator-request
Details | Review
48 bytes, text/x-phabricator-request
Details | Review
48 bytes, text/x-phabricator-request
Details | Review
48 bytes, text/x-phabricator-request
Details | Review

When we shut down the rollout we reverted the triggers to the old ones, but also stopped showing the custom UI. Andy agrees it makes sense to make the two independent and release the custom prompt UI by default already.

Attachment #9524998 - Attachment description: Bug 1998628 - Part 1: Refactor ReviewPromptMiddleware to separate triggers from prompt type → Bug 1998628 - Part 2: Refactor ReviewPromptMiddleware to separate triggers from prompt type
Attachment #9524999 - Attachment description: Bug 1998628 - Part 2: Enable custom prompt by default, keep the flag to control only criteria → Bug 1998628 - Part 3: Enable custom prompt by default, keep the flag to control only criteria
Pushed by mkozinski@mozilla.com: https://github.com/mozilla-firefox/firefox/commit/3c9266b72d15 https://hg.mozilla.org/integration/autoland/rev/e93bd4d0a187 Part 1: Add tests for review prompt feature flag and legacy criteria r=android-reviewers,gmalekpour https://github.com/mozilla-firefox/firefox/commit/ba6019b1c2cb https://hg.mozilla.org/integration/autoland/rev/86be457c09ab Part 2: Refactor ReviewPromptMiddleware to separate triggers from prompt type r=android-reviewers,twhite https://github.com/mozilla-firefox/firefox/commit/e6e6512ca523 https://hg.mozilla.org/integration/autoland/rev/29ecaca3490a Part 3: Enable custom prompt by default, keep the flag to control only criteria r=android-reviewers,twhite
Status: ASSIGNED → RESOLVED
Closed: 4 months ago
Resolution: --- → FIXED
Target Milestone: --- → 147 Branch
Attachment #9526424 - Flags: approval-mozilla-beta?
Attachment #9526425 - Flags: approval-mozilla-beta?

firefox-beta Uplift Approval Request

  • User impact if declined: We will continue to receive lower average ratings.
  • Code covered by automated testing: yes
  • Fix verified in Nightly: yes
  • Needs manual QE test: no
  • Steps to reproduce for manual QE testing:
  • Risk associated with taking this patch: low
  • Explanation of risk level: This feature has been in release since 142. This small behaviour change enables it in an additional scenario.
  • String changes made/needed: no
  • Is Android affected?: yes
Attachment #9526426 - Flags: approval-mozilla-beta?
Attachment #9526424 - Flags: approval-mozilla-beta? → approval-mozilla-beta+
Attachment #9526425 - Flags: approval-mozilla-beta? → approval-mozilla-beta+
Attachment #9526426 - Flags: approval-mozilla-beta? → approval-mozilla-beta+
Attachment #9527125 - Flags: approval-mozilla-release?
Attachment #9527126 - Flags: approval-mozilla-release?
Attachment #9527128 - Flags: approval-mozilla-release?

firefox-release Uplift Approval Request

  • User impact if declined: We will continue to receive lower average ratings.
  • Code covered by automated testing: yes
  • Fix verified in Nightly: yes
  • Needs manual QE test: no
  • Steps to reproduce for manual QE testing:
  • Risk associated with taking this patch: low
  • Explanation of risk level: This feature has been in release since 142. This small behaviour change enables it in an additional scenario. Nightly and Beta 3 show no signs of any issues related to this change.
  • String changes made/needed: no
  • Is Android affected?: yes
Attachment #9527125 - Flags: approval-mozilla-release? → approval-mozilla-release+
Attachment #9527126 - Flags: approval-mozilla-release? → approval-mozilla-release+
Attachment #9527128 - Flags: approval-mozilla-release? → approval-mozilla-release+
Regressions: 2001801
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: